Tea Brewing Technique
Brewing green tea for smoothies is all about detail. Here’s how to get the best flavor:
- Use filtered water at 175-185°F
- Steep green tea for 2-3 minutes
- Let the tea cool to room temperature
- Strain the tea leaves completely
Ingredient Preparation
Getting your ingredients ready is key for cucumber smoothies. Choose fresh, crisp items and prepare them well:
- Wash all produce thoroughly
- Chop cucumber into small chunks
- Remove seeds for a smoother texture
- Measure ingredients precisely

How long can I store a Cucumber Green Tea Smoothie in the refrigerator?
Store your smoothie in an airtight container for 24-48 hours in the fridge. For the best taste and nutrients, drink it as soon as you can. If it separates, just stir it well before drinking.
Can I use matcha instead of regular green tea in this smoothie?
Yes, you can! Matcha is a great choice. It’s packed with antioxidants and gives your smoothie a vibrant green color. Use 1-2 teaspoons of matcha powder for the best taste and health benefits.
Is this smoothie suitable for weight loss?
Yes, it’s a good choice for weight loss. It’s low in calories but full of nutrients. The green tea and cucumber help boost your metabolism and keep you hydrated.
Can I make this smoothie vegan?
The recipe is already vegan. Use plant-based milk like almond, coconut, or oat milk. For protein, choose plant-based powders from pea, hemp, or rice.
How can I make the smoothie more filling?
Add chia seeds, Greek yogurt, or protein powder to make it more filling. These ingredients increase protein and fiber, helping you stay full longer.
Are there any alternatives if I don’t like cucumber?
If you don’t like cucumber, try zucchini or celery. They have a similar texture and mild taste. You can also add extra green apple for a different flavor.
Can I prepare the ingredients in advance?
Yes! Cut cucumbers and freeze them in bags. Brew green tea ahead of time and chill it. Preparing ahead makes your smoothie prep quick and easy.

Cucumber Green Tea Smoothie
Equipment
- Blender
- Knife
- Cutting board
- Measuring Cups
Ingredients
- 1/2 medium cucumber chopped
- 1/2 cup brewed green tea cooled
- 1/2 green apple chopped
- 3 handfuls baby spinach or kale
- 1 tsp fresh ginger optional
- 1/2 cup ice cubes
- 1/4 cup coconut water optional
Instructions
- Brew green tea, let it cool to room temperature.
- Wash and chop all produce.
- Add green tea, cucumber, apple, spinach/kale, and ginger into a blender.
- Blend on high for 45-60 seconds until smooth.
- Add ice cubes and coconut water (if using) and blend again.
- Serve immediately and enjoy!
